Bulut Servisleri: Temel İlkeler
Giriş: Bulut Bilişimin Yükselişi
Günümüzde teknoloji dünyası, bulut bilişim kavramı etrafında şekilleniyor. Bulut servisleri, bireylerden büyük ölçekli işletmelere kadar herkesin verilerini, uygulamalarını ve altyapılarını internet üzerinden erişilebilir bir şekilde yönetmesini sağlıyor. Bu da, geleneksel yöntemlere kıyasla esneklik, ölçeklenebilirlik ve maliyet avantajı gibi önemli kazanımlar sunuyor. Artık şirketler, donanım yatırımı yapmak, sunucuları yönetmek ve sistem güncellemeleriyle uğraşmak yerine, ihtiyaç duydukları kaynakları bir hizmet olarak alabiliyorlar. Peki, bu devrimin temelinde yatan ilkeler nelerdir?
Gelişme: Bulut Servislerinin Temel İlkeleri
Bulut servislerinin sunduğu avantajlardan tam olarak yararlanabilmek için, bu servislerin temel ilkelerini anlamak kritik önem taşıyor. Bu ilkeler, bulut bilişimin sunduğu esnekliği, ölçeklenebilirliği ve verimliliği mümkün kılan temel taşları oluşturuyor.
1. Talep Üzerine Hizmet (On-Demand Service)
Bulut servislerinin en önemli özelliklerinden biri, kullanıcıların ihtiyaç duydukları kaynaklara (depolama, işlem gücü, yazılım vb.) anında erişebilmeleridir. Tıpkı elektrik veya su gibi, kullanıcılar kullandıkları kadar ödeme yaparlar. Bu sayede, gereksiz kaynak yatırımlarından kaçınılmış olur.
2. Geniş Ağ Erişimi (Broad Network Access)
Bulut servislerine, herhangi bir cihazdan (bilgisayar, tablet, akıllı telefon vb.) ve herhangi bir yerden internet bağlantısı aracılığıyla erişilebilir. Bu, kullanıcıların ofiste veya seyahatte olmalarına bakılmaksızın, verilere ve uygulamalara her zaman ulaşabilmeleri anlamına gelir. Bu ilke, iş sürekliliğini ve çalışanların verimliliğini artırır.
3. Kaynak Havuzlama (Resource Pooling)
Bulut sağlayıcıları, birden fazla müşteriye aynı fiziksel kaynakları (sunucular, depolama cihazları vb.) paylaştırırlar. Bu sayede, kaynaklar daha verimli kullanılır ve maliyetler düşürülür. Müşteriler, hangi fiziksel kaynağı kullandıklarını bilmezler ve bu durum, onlara herhangi bir ek yük getirmez. Bu ilke, bulut bilişimin ölçeklenebilirliğinin temelini oluşturur.
4. Hızlı Elastikiyet (Rapid Elasticity)
Bulut servisleri, ihtiyaç duyulan kaynakların hızlı bir şekilde artırılabilmesini veya azaltılabilmesini sağlar. Bu sayede, ani talep artışlarına veya azalışlarına kolayca uyum sağlanabilir. Örneğin, bir e-ticaret sitesi, kampanya dönemlerinde artan trafiği karşılamak için işlem gücünü anında artırabilir ve kampanya sona erdiğinde eski seviyesine geri dönebilir.
5. Ölçülebilir Hizmet (Measured Service)
Bulut servis sağlayıcıları, müşterilerin kullandıkları kaynakları (işlem gücü, depolama alanı, ağ trafiği vb.) sürekli olarak izler ve ölçer. Bu sayede, müşterilere kullandıkları kadar ödeme yapma imkanı sunulur. Ayrıca, bu ölçümler sayesinde kaynak kullanımı optimize edilebilir ve maliyetler daha iyi yönetilebilir.
Bulut Hizmet Modelleri
IaaS (Altyapı Olarak Hizmet)
Bulut altyapısının (sunucular, depolama, ağ) kiralandığı modeldir. Kullanıcı, işletim sistemi ve uygulamaları kendisi yönetir.
PaaS (Platform Olarak Hizmet)
Uygulama geliştirmek, çalıştırmak ve yönetmek için bir platform sağlanır. Geliştiriciler, altyapı yönetimiyle uğraşmak zorunda kalmadan uygulamalarına odaklanabilirler.
SaaS (Yazılım Olarak Hizmet)
Uygulamanın tamamı bir hizmet olarak sunulur. Kullanıcılar, herhangi bir kurulum veya yönetim yapmadan uygulamayı kullanabilirler. Örneğin, Gmail, Salesforce gibi uygulamalar SaaS modeline örnektir.
“Bulut bilişim, bir devrimden çok, teknolojinin evrimidir.” – Werner Vogels, Amazon CTO
Sonuç: Bulut Bilişim ve Gelecek
Bulut servislerinin temel ilkeleri, teknoloji dünyasına getirdiği yeniliklerin ve avantajların temelini oluşturuyor. Talep üzerine hizmet, geniş ağ erişimi, kaynak havuzlama, hızlı elastikiyet ve ölçülebilir hizmet ilkeleri sayesinde, işletmeler daha çevik, daha verimli ve daha rekabetçi hale geliyorlar. Bulut bilişim, sadece bir teknoloji trendi değil, aynı zamanda iş yapış şekillerini kökten değiştiren bir dönüşüm. Gelecekte, bulut servislerinin daha da yaygınlaşması ve daha da gelişmesi bekleniyor. Yapay zeka, makine öğrenimi ve büyük veri gibi teknolojilerin bulut bilişimle entegrasyonu, yeni nesil uygulamaların ve hizmetlerin ortaya çıkmasına olanak sağlayacak.
Bu ilkeleri anlamak ve doğru bir şekilde uygulamak, bulut bilişimin sunduğu potansiyelden en iyi şekilde yararlanmanın anahtarıdır. Şirketler, bulut stratejilerini oluştururken bu temel prensipleri göz önünde bulundurarak, başarılı bir bulut dönüşümü gerçekleştirebilirler.